SteemConnect is a tool built by @steemit and
@busy.org to help apps access your Steem account securely and easily. You've probably seen it at work when:
SteemConnect is used by apps such as MinnowBooster, Busy.org, and even Utopian to access your Steem Blockchain account without forcing you to hand over private information such as your private keys. However, currently it isn't very easy to handle actions such as editing an app's permissions or revoking permissions.
In order to retract delegation, edit permissions, or revoke an app, you have to create your own specialized link, then visit that link. For example, below is the link to undelegate power from an account randomperson:
https://v2.steemconnect.com/sign/undelegate-vesting-shares?delegatee=randompersonRather than forming these links on the fly and testing them out, it would be easier if there were control panels on the SteemConnect.com website where we could easily perform such actions.
Below is an example graphic I created for a possible apps/permissions control panel:
In my design, all you have to do is visit the Apps and Permissions panel in the website. You're then presented with an overview of every app you've given permissions/power to. If you want to edit an app's permissions or add more permissions, you can click the yellow Edit button next to the app's logo.
If you want to delete an app from your panel and revoke all permissions, you can press the red Revoke button next to the app. Below these buttons and the app logo is a list of all the permissions the app has, such as "Post, Vote, Comment."

The next control panel would be a delegation center where the user could easily control delegations. They could see all incoming/outgoing delegations, and add more if wanted.
Below is an example graphic I created for a possible delegation center panel:
At the top of my example is a tool allowing you to quickly delegate Steem Power (SP) or Vests to any other user/account. You can fill out the fields to set the receiving user and the SP amount, then press Confirm to quickly secure your transaction with SteemConnect.
The orange text in the delegation tool allows you to see how your delegation would affect you and the other account, by seeing how your vote worth and SP would change, and how their vote worth and SP would change.
At the bottom could be a quick overview of the delegations you're receiving and the ones you're giving out. Another added feature could be the possibility to quickly revoke outgoing delegations from that panel.
Though these are just mock-ups of how these panels could look like, it would be great if SteemConnect added control panels for permissions and delegations similar to these.
